摘 要:本试验旨在研究饲粮营养水平对中速型黄羽肉鸡生长性能、胴体品质、肉品质、风味和血浆生化指标的影响。选用1、29、57日龄中速型岭南黄羽肉鸡各1 920、1 920和1 440只(公母各1/2),试验分为3个阶段,每个阶段根据本课题组提出的黄羽肉鸡饲养标准上下浮动分别设置低营养水平组、中营养水平组和高营养水平组及以我国《鸡饲养标准》(NY/T 33—2004)为标准的标准营养水平组。每组公鸡6个重复,母鸡6个重复,每个重复30~40只鸡。试验期84 d。结果表明:1) 1~28日龄,公鸡方面,高营养水平组的平均日增重显著高于低营养水平组和中营养水平组(P<0.05),高营养水平组和标准营养水平组的平均日采食量显著高于低营养水平组和中营养水平组(P<0.05),低营养水平组的料重比显著高于其他营养水平组(P<0.05);母鸡方面,低营养水平组的平均日增重显著低于其他营养水平组(P<0.05),标准营养水平组的平均日采食量显著高于低营养水平组(P<0.05),中营养水平组的料重比显著低于低营养水平组(P<0.05)。29~56日龄,公鸡方面,低营养水平组的料重比显著高于其他营养水平组(P <0.05);母鸡方面,低营养水平组的平均日增重显著低于其他营养水平组(P<0.05),中营养水平组和标准营养水平组的平均日采食量显著高于高营养水平组(P<0.05),低营养水平组的料重比显著高于高营养水平组和标准营养水平组(P<0.05)。57~84日龄,高营养水平组公鸡和母鸡的平均日增重均显著高于标准营养水平组(P<0.05),高营养水平组母鸡的料重比显著低于其他营养水平组(P<0.05)。2)标准营养水平组母鸡的腹脂率显著低于高营养水平组(P<0.05)。饲粮营养水平对公鸡和母鸡的屠体率、半净膛率、全净膛率、腿肌率、胸肌率、胫骨折断力均无显著影响(P>0.05)。3)高营养水平组公鸡的45 min肉色黄度值显著高于低营养水平组和标�This experiment was conducted to investigate the effects of dietary nutrient level on growth performance,carcass quality,meat quality,flavor and plasma biochemical parameters of medium-growing yellow-feathered broilers.A total of 1 920,1 920 and 1 440 medium-growing Lingnan yellow-feathered broilers at 1,29 and 57 days of age were selected,respectively.The experiment divided into 3 stages,at each stage,the low nutrient level group,medium nutrient level group and high nutrient level group were set up according to our research group standard up or down for yellow-feathered broilers,and the standard nutrient group was set up according to standard of Standard of Chicken Feeding(NY/T 33-2004).There were 6 replicates of male broilers in each group and 6 replicates of female broilers in each group,each replicate had 30 to 40 broilers.The experiment lasted for 84 days.The results showed as follows:1)during 1 to 28 days of age,for male broilers,the average daily gain(ADG)of high nutrient level group was significantly higher than that of low nutrient level group and medium nutrient level group(P<0.05),the average daily feed intake(ADFI)of high nutrient level group and standard nutrient level group was significantly higher than that of low nutrient level group and medium nutrient level group(P<0.05),and the feed to gain ratio(F/G)of low nutrient level group was significantly higher than that of other nutrient level groups(P<0.05);for female broilers,the ADG of low nutrient level group was significantly lower than that of other nutrient level groups(P<0.05),the ADFI of standard nutrient level group was significantly higher than that of low nutrient level group(P<0.05),the F/G of medium nutrient level group was significantly lower than that of low nutrient level group(P<0.05).During 29 to 56 days of age,for male broilers,the F/G of low nutrient level group was significantly higher than that of other nutrient level groups(P<0.05);for female broilers,the ADG of low nutrient level group was significantly lower than that of other
